The Future of Japanese Workforce: Spotlight on Foreign Worker Programs
Japan's aging population presents a significant obstacle to its future. To address this demographic shift, the country is increasingly turning to non-Japanese worker programs. These initiatives aim to draw skilled workers from around the world to fill critical vacancies in various sectors. The success of these programs will be crucial for Japan's ability to maintain its economic strength in the years to come.
One key element of these programs is the creation of adaptive visa policies that accommodate the needs of both employers and foreign workers. This includes streamlining the application process, expanding eligible professions, and granting support for language acquisition. Additionally, there is a growing focus on integrating foreign workers into Japanese communities through programs that promote awareness.
The long-term impact of these initiatives remains to be seen. However, the resolve of the Japanese government to address its workforce challenges through foreign worker programs indicates a readiness to adapt and evolve in the face of demographic change.
